On multilinear oscillatory integrals, nonsingular and singular

Abstract
Basic questions concerning nonsingular multilinear operators with oscillatory factors are posed and partially answered. Lebesgue space norm inequalities are established for multilinear integral operators of Calderon-Zygmund type which incorporate oscillatory factors exp(iP), where P is a real-valued polynomial with large coefficients. A related problem concerning upper bounds for measures of sublevel sets is solved.
